What is the cheapest month to fly from Brisbane to Peru?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Brisbane to Peru,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Brisbane to Peru is January, when tickets cost $1,610 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are September and July, when the average cost of return tickets is $2,168 and $2,058 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Brisbane to Peru?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Brisbane to Peru,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below-average price on a flight from Brisbane to Peru, you should book around 4 weeks before departure, which saves you about 13% compared to booking last-min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 16 weeks before departure.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Brisbane to Peru?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ional return ticket. You could then fly from Brisbane to Peru with an airline and back with another airline.

  • What is KAYAK's "flexible dates" feature and why should I care when looking for a flight from Brisbane to Peru?

    Sometimes travel dates aren't set in stone. If your preferred travel dates have some wiggle room, flexible dates will show you all the options when flying from Brisbane to Peru up to 3 days before/after your preferred dates. You can then pick the flights that suit you best.
